1. 程式人生 > >【halcon】全球常用機器視覺軟體介紹

【halcon】全球常用機器視覺軟體介紹

做機器視覺行業的硬體時間不短了,也接觸到不少機器視覺軟體,下面版本介紹一下常用的常用的機器視覺軟體。

一、開源的OpenCV

機器視覺最常用的軟體是OpenCV(Intel OpenSource Computer Vision Library),最大優點是開源,可以進行二次開發,目前有2版本和3.2版本,語法上面有一定的區別。

二、VisionPro系統,快速開發強大的應用系統

康耐視公司(Cognex )推出的 VisionPro 系統 VisionPro 使得製造商、系統整合商、工程師可以快速開發和配置出強大的機器視覺應用系統。目前最新版本為9.2版本,並且取消了軟體授權的形式,硬體授權價格在1.5萬-3萬不等。

三、LabVIEW軟體

美國NI公司的應用軟體LabVIEW機器視覺軟體程式設計速度是最快的。LabVIEW是基於程式程式碼的一種圖形化程式語言。其提供了大量的影象預處理、影象分割、影象理解函式庫和開發工具,使用者只要在流程圖中用圖示聯結器將所需要的子VI(VirtualInstruments LabVIEW開發程式)連線起來就可以完成目標任務。任何1個VI都有3部分組成:可互動的使用者介面、流程圖和圖示聯結器。LabVIEW程式設計簡單,而且對工件的正確識別率很高,目前在尺寸測量方面應用比較廣泛,如一鍵式測量儀等產品。

四、德國的MVTecHALCON視覺軟體-這是目前全球應用最廣、最強大的一款軟體

HALCON是德國MVtec公司開發的一套完善的標準的機器視覺演算法包,擁有應用廣泛的機器視覺整合開發環境。它節約了產品成本,縮短了軟體開發週期——HALCON靈活的架構便於機器視覺,醫學影象和影象分析應用的快速開發。在歐洲以及日本的工業界已經是公認具有最佳效能的Machine Vision軟體。目前最新版本是2013版本,在視覺應用方面使用的比較廣泛。

本人從業視覺8年了,給大家推薦一套halcon教程:

五、MATLAB相關的工具箱

如下:

Image Processing Toolbox (影象處理工具箱)

Computer Vision System Toolbox (計算機視覺工具箱)

Image Acquisition Toolbox (影象採集工具箱)

這個軟體瞭解的比較少,也有一定的使用人群。

以上只是介紹了主流的幾款機器視覺影象處理軟體,歡迎補充和指正。

敲黑板:本人經常會發一些對大家學習非常有參考價值的帖子和分享一些視覺halcon學習的資料,大家可以關注我以及看下我其他帖子。